Dietary and physical activity interventions are fundamental in the comprehensive management of hypertension, offering potent non-pharmacological strategies to control blood pressure and improve cardiovascular health. The cornerstone of a heart-healthy diet for hypertension management involves a rich intake of fruits, vegetables, whole grains, and lean proteins, while concurrently limiting sodium, saturated fats, and added sugars. These dietary modifications have a substantial impact on lowering blood pressure levels [1].
Regular engagement in physical activity, encompassing both aerobic and resistance training, further contributes to effective blood pressure regulation. This is achieved through improvements in overall cardiovascular health and the promotion of healthy weight management, essential components for mitigating hypertension risks [1].
The DASH (Dietary Approaches to Stop Hypertension) diet stands out as a highly effective dietary pattern. It emphasizes the consumption of fruits, vegetables, and low-fat dairy products, alongside a significant reduction in saturated and total fat intake, demonstrating considerable blood pressure-lowering effects [2].
When the DASH diet is combined with regular physical activity, particularly aerobic exercise, its efficacy is significantly amplified. This synergy enhances endothelial function and vascular compliance, making it a central tenet in current hypertension management guidelines [2].
Sodium restriction is a critical dietary adjustment for effective hypertension control. A notable decrease in blood pressure can be achieved by reducing the intake of processed foods, which are often laden with sodium, and by prioritizing fresh, home-prepared meals [3].
This dietary shift towards reduced sodium, when coupled with consistent moderate-intensity exercise, significantly amplifies the overall benefits derived from lifestyle interventions in managing elevated blood pressure [3].
Weight management, achieved through a combination of appropriate diet and regular exercise, is intrinsically linked to successful hypertension control. Even a modest reduction in body weight can lead to a significant lowering of blood pressure readings [4].
A balanced diet designed to create a calorie deficit, in conjunction with regular physical activity aimed at increasing energy expenditure, forms the basis for achieving and maintaining a healthy weight. This, in turn, leads to improved blood pressure control [4].
Aerobic exercise, including activities such as brisk walking, jogging, or swimming, plays a crucial role in reducing both systolic and diastolic blood pressure by enhancing cardiovascular function and improving blood vessel elasticity, especially when complemented by dietary modifications [5].

While aerobic exercise is well-established, resistance training also contributes positively to blood pressure reduction, particularly when integrated with aerobic exercise and a balanced diet. It enhances body composition and metabolic health, indirectly benefiting blood pressure control. A comprehensive lifestyle approach that includes both dietary adjustments and varied physical activity is most effective [6].
Limiting alcohol consumption is another crucial dietary factor in hypertension management, as excessive alcohol intake can elevate blood pressure. When combined with a low-sodium diet and regular physical activity, moderating alcohol intake forms part of a holistic strategy for effective blood pressure control [7].
Incorporating potassium-rich foods, such as bananas, spinach, and sweet potatoes, can help mitigate the effects of sodium and contribute to lower blood pressure. A diet that includes these foods, alongside reduced sodium intake and consistent physical activity, supports improved cardiovascular health and hypertension management [8].

The synergistic effect of diet and exercise on hypertension is substantial. Combining a balanced, nutrient-dense diet with regular physical activity leads to more profound and sustained blood pressure reduction than either intervention alone, making this integrated approach vital for comprehensive hypertension management [9].
Mindful eating practices, focusing on whole, unprocessed foods, and engaging in enjoyable forms of regular physical activity contribute to overall well-being and positively impact blood pressure. These sustainable lifestyle changes are crucial for long-term hypertension control [10].
